HIP 87823

HIP 87823 is a A-type (White) star located in the constellation Hercules.

Located approximately 785.9 light-years from Earth, HIP 87823 resides within the broader disk of our Milky Way galaxy.

HIP 87823 is classified as a spectral class A star (A-type (White)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.

HIP 87823 has an apparent magnitude of +6.66, placing it beyond naked-eye visibility. A good pair of binoculars or a small telescope is required to observe this star. Observers will note its white h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+0.400.
